ORDER:

This Transfer Civil Miscellaneous petition is filed under Section 24 of the Code of Cirril procedure, l9og, by the petitioner, who is the wife of the respondent, seeking the Court to transfer G.W.O.p.No.g9O of 2023 pending on the hle of the learned Judge, Family Court at Kalpataru, Hyderabad, to the file of the learned Judge, Family Court at Halamkonda or Waranga.l. F.C.O.p.No.89 1 of 2023 was f,rled by the respondent-husband under Section I 3 (l ) (ia) of the Hindu Marriage Act, 1955 seeking dissolution of marriage.

  1. The facts of the case a-re that the marriage between petitioner and the respondent was solemni zed, on 06.os.2or7 . After the marriage, they lead their marital life for some period and they blessed with two children. After that the disputes arose between them, the respondent-husband frled F.C.O.P.No.89L of 2023, pending on the file of the learned Judge, Family Court at Kalpataru, Hyderabad, for dissolution of marriage. Later, petitioner-wife filed G.W.O.p.No.g90 of 2023, for the custody of the minor children and also registered a case in Crime No.242 of 2023 for the offences punishable

l'

under Sections 498-A, 506 of Indian Penal Code a-nd Sections 3, 4 of the Dowry Prohibition Act.

  1. Heard Sri Anil Kumar Gaju, Iearned counsel for the petitioner as well as Sri B.Anil Kumar Yadav, Iearned counsel appearing on behalf of the respondent.

  2. l,earned counsel for the petitioner would submit that the petitioner is residing with her pa-rents at Hanamkonda and she is dependent on her parents. Learned counsel further submitted that whenever the petitioner is attending the Court at Kalpataru, Hyderabad, the respondent husband is threatening her, as such, prayed the Court to transfer G.W.O.P.No.B9O of 2023 from [he {ile of learned Judge, Family Court at Kalpataru, Hyderabad to the lile of iearneci Judge' Family Court at Hanamkonda or Warangal'

  3. On the other hand, learned counsel lor the respondent submitted that the said G.W.O.P has to be hlecl where the minor children are residing as per Section 9 of the Guardian ald Wards Act, 1956, as such, the Court at Hanamkonda or Warangal has no jurisdiction to entertain the same'

2

  1. Having regard to the rival submissions made by both the counsel ald having gone through the material available on record, since the minor children a-re not residing in the jurisdiction of Waranga-l or Hanamakonda District, the Transfer Civil Miscellaneous Petition is liable to be dismissed.

<sup>7</sup>. Accordingly, the Transfer Civil Miscellaneous Petition is dismissed. There shall be no order as to costs.
